2017-02-18 4 views
0

Wenn ich den Code Die Funktionen laufen nicht hier das Problem Code hoffen, dass Sie bei allen
arbeiten kann helfen:Python Schildkröte wie zu onKey Funktionen in While-Schleife?

import turtle 

.
.
.

plinput = 0 
while plinput == 0: 

def OnePlayer(): 
    global plinput 
    plinput = 1 

def TwoPlayers(): 
    global plinput 
    plinput = 1 

def ThreePlayers(): 
    global plinput 
    plinput = 1 

def FourPlayers(): 
    global plinput 
    plinput = 1 

onkey(Oneplayer, "1") 
onkey(TwoPlayers, "2") 
onkey(ThreePlayers, "3") 
onkey(FourPlayers, "4")<br> 

.
.
.

Danke es ist sehr wichtig

+0

Nur raten: Vielleicht geht es nur um Sie Einzug Ihrer Zeilen !? Bitte geben Sie ein vollständiges und lauffähiges Beispiel an. http://stackoverflow.com/help/mcve – infotoni91

+0

Bitte erklären Sie, was das erwartete Verhalten dieses Codes ist. Was erwarten Sie, wenn Sie diesen Code ausführen? –

Antwort

0

Bitte erklären Sie, was Sie Ihren Code tun möchten. Außerdem gibt es einen Einrückungsfehler nach der While-Schleife, wo Funktionen starten.

while plinput == 0: 

    def OnePlayer(): 
     global plinput 
     plinput = 1 

    def TwoPlayers(): 
     global plinput 
     plinput = 1 

    def ThreePlayers(): 
     global plinput 
     plinput = 1 

    def FourPlayers(): 
     global plinput 
     plinput = 1 

Hoffe, das hilft. :)